Aims Vincristine‐induced peripheral neuropathy (VIPN) is a common side effect in children and adolescents treated with vincristine. Assessing VIPN, especially in young children, is challenging due to a lack of sensitive tools. This limits our understanding of the nature and risk factors of VIPN.
